A qualitative and quantitative analysis of the structure of Fe-Cu-C alloys obtained as a result of interaction of Fe-Cu melts with graphite upon wetting has been carried out by means of optical and electron microscopy. Based on the investigations performed, it has been shown that the technique of contact alloying allows one to obtain multilayered composite materials.
